Abstract

The purpose of this paper is to highlight how teaching a critical and problematizing bioethics is responsible for encouraging and building a form of citizenship exercise able to develop: a certain type of attitude; a volunteer election conducted by some people; a mode of relationship to the current situation; a way of thinking and feeling, acting and behaving, which in turn indicates a belonging, and presents itself as a task. In short, an ethos.
